GENERAL SUMMARY

The Benefits Analyst is responsible for administering and maintaining company benefit and retirement programs, including medical, dental, vision, life insurance, short-and long-term disability, 401(k) plan, workers' compensation, and wellness. This position informs and guides team members on benefit matters regarding eligibility, coverage, and provisions; compiles and maintains benefit records and documentation, and is responsible for compliance activities.

ESSENTAIL FUNCTIONS

  • Conducts new-hire benefit orientation

  • Respond to benefits inquiries from managers and team members on plan provisions, benefits enrollments, status changes, and other general inquiries

  • Enroll team members with benefit carriers as necessary and process life status changes

  • Enters changes and benefits enrollments in the Human Resources Information System (HRIS) to provide vendors with accurate eligibility information

  • Respond to 401(k) inquiries from managers and team members relating to enrollment, plan changes, and contribution amounts; and manage the annual catch-up contribution enrollment

  • Facilitates all benefit-related information and communication for team members, retirees, and COBRA for terminated team members

  • Perform quality checks on benefits-related data

  • Determines benefit eligibility and distributes all benefits enrollment materials to team members

  • Administers open enrollment process

  • Acts as a liaison with insurance brokers

  • Assists with processing and administering leave-of-absence requests and disability paperwork: medical, personal, disability, and FMLA as needed

  • Provide necessary reports for allocation/billing charges

  • Responsible for regulatory reporting activities and requirements; such as notices, Affordable Care Act (ACA), creditable coverage, audits, etc.

  • Responsible for recording and providing follow-up on Worker's Compensation; and applicable regulatory obligations (i.e. OSHA 300A)

  • Reviews and authorizes all bi-weekly benefit changes for accuracy

  • Promotes a healthy lifestyle to team members through communications, wellness program initiatives, and educational events for team members

  • Other duties as assigned

RE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ES

  • Strong knowledge benefits administration processes

  • Effectively interprets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), Family & Medical Leave Act (FMLA), and other leave law implications as they relate to leaves of absences/disabilities

  • Knowledge of Workers' Compensation record keeping and reporting requirements

  • Excellent inter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ills

  • Excellent organizational and time management skills

  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ail

  • Experience using Microsoft Office applications, specifically Excel

  • Ability to maintain a high-level of confidentiality

  • Ability to work independently

REQUIRED E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

Required:

  • Bachelor's degree in HR or related field and/or equivalent work experience; plus

  • A minimum of four (4) years of experience administering benefits in Human Resources

  • Experience working with Ultimate Software (UKG Pro) or similar Human Resources Information System (HRIS) software

Preferred:

  • SHRM Certified Professional (SHRM-CP) or SHRM Senior Certified Professional (SHRM-SCP) certification credential

  • CEBS designation a plus

  • Business intelligence report writing a plus

RELATIONSHIPS

  • Reports To: Vice President, Human Resources

  • Directly Manages: None

  • Internal and external relationships: Internal management and non-management team members, external benefit vendors, UKG and other regulatory agencies
